Anyway, my family and I will be going to Alaska next July (YAY!!!). I had a question about the itinerary and ship vs port time. It says we are in Skagway from 7am-9pm, but I know Skagway is one hour behind Seattle where we embark. Does that mean we arrive at 7am Skagway time? Or do they keep "ship" time the same as Seattle, which would make our arrival time 6am local? Trying to make some plans with outside companies. nybumpkin Posted August 13, 2014 #5 Share Posted August 13, 2014 We just cruised on Miracle last month. We set our clocks back one hour before reaching the Alaska ports and then set our clocks ahead one hour before arriving in Victoria on the last day.
